Gaultauto might be able to help you out, there is a link in the post above yours. mujxx 06-23-2007, 10:03 PM found this useful information: 850 M-Technic Body Parts (CSi) Part Description BMW Part No. Qty List Price Front Spoiler 51-11-2-253-000 1 $ 892.00 Rear Valance 51-12-2-253-005 1 $ 315.00 Installation Kit <1> 82 11 9 402 709 1 $ 206.00 Flap Cover for Rear Valance 51-12-2-256-195 1 $ 33.00 CSi Mirror Body--Left 51-16-2-253-835 1 $ 384.00 CSi Mirror Body--Right 51-16-2-253-836 1 $ 384.00 Mirror Glass--Left 51-16-2-267-191 1 $ 90.50 Mirror Glass--Right 51-16-2-267-192 1 $ 94.75 Lower Grill (License Cover) 51-11-1-970-220 1 $ 9.70 Note <1>, Installation Kit Contents: Reinforcement Rear Spoiler 51-12-2-252-015 1 $ 137.00 Clips 51-12-1-946-136 2 $ 1.66 Foil 51-12-2-252-014 1 $ 13.30 Air Duct-Front Spoiler 51-71-2-252-004 1 $ ?
